Output 70fa79bf23a628233cefe1c9556651eeb7eec8e53fa6125b0e137c5114da9309:1

value
19253472
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0a3aafa8f929e4d56462c00deaeae5141217ce3d OP_EQUALVERIFY OP_CHECKSIG
address
1w64WHuT7r3ufCpYeta1B9B7Gi2uva4JP
transaction
70fa79bf23a628233cefe1c9556651eeb7eec8e53fa6125b0e137c5114da9309
spent
true